Commercial Description:
Voilá! A beer from chilly Quebec inspired by the "rauchbier" you find in Bamberg, Germany — a dark beer made partly from smoked malt, aged slowly at low temperatures, and put in the bottle unfiltered, with a fine yeast sediment. All for one!

750ml Bottle from Champanes, label on the bottle is different than the label shown on RateBeer, and reads 5.9% alc. not 6.0%, also, the name on the label is ‘Rauchbier’ not ‘S.S. Rauchbier’, anyway, I am sure this is the same beer. This Rauchbier has a dark brown-black pour (ruby when held to a light) with an initial chocolate shake tan head that fades to a ring, I found a thin film of sediment in the bottle, the pour has aromas of dry chocolate, charred wood smoke and fire place smoke with faint licorice, malt, coffee and earthiness? fragrances in the background, smoke and chocolate flavors are prevailing in this drink with a little coffee, and I found the smoke flavor is stronger than what my nose let on to, mouth feel is a little less than medium, nice drinking smoke beer.
